Meth users who suffer a meth-induced panic and psychosis can be extremely dangerous and may give way to extreme violence.
Parents who are concerned that their child is abusing meth should keep an eye out for extremely dilated pupils, dry or bleeding nose and lips, chronic nasal or sinus problems and bad breath.
Today, experts state that more women are developing problems with meth than cocaine.
Just like other stimulants, meth is typically used in a "binge and crash" pattern.
When a person takes meth it increases the levels of the neurotransmitter dopamine. This stimulates brain cells, enhancing mood and body movement.
